The 9th Annual Gross Domestic Product has been scheduled for Saturday, April 12th in the East Village. Main stages will be held at Wooly’s and House of Bricks, with performances and pop-up shows happening in other spaces throughout the neighborhood. Between 15-20 local musical artists will perform; three of those spots will be selected through an online vote.

If you’d like to be considered for one of these spots, submit a song to the event’s Volunteer Director Angela Rauch by emailing angela@desmoinesmc.com. The song must be an MP3 and include the song name and artist name in the file as follows: SONGNAME_ARTISTNAME.mp3

Submissions are due by Sunday, February 23rd at 5pm. Songs will be posted for public vote on Monday, February 24th. The voting results will be tallied and the selected artists, along with the full lineup for Gross Domestic Product, will be announced at the Greater Des Moines Music Coalition’s Backstage Ball on Friday, February 28th.

Gross Domestic Product specifically aims to highlight those original artists in our community who are working to promote their music through recordings, music videos, online marketing, touring, and more, and have been particularly active in the last year.
